GAINtalk 4: Lessons from the Sydney Roosters (with Lachlan Penfold)
In this 66 minute presentation, Melbourne Storm director of performance Lachlan Penfold breaks down the lessons he learned while helping Sydney Roosters to the National Rugby League title in 2013, including his approach to athlete monitoring and performance. About GAIN
GAIN is a coaching network offering coaches a community to grow, and annual events to learn and network. The annual flagship GAIN event takes place in June with details announced in December. The week-long event brings together top coaches from around the world to share best practices on athletic development, sports medicine, the art of coaching, and more.
